    Default Out of sight out of mind?

    There's a new law in Canada now that cigarettes must no longer be on display. Walk into any variety store (in most provinces) and there behind the cashier is a big wall of..well..hidden smokes. This is supposed to deter young people from smoking. Out of sight out of mind right?
    What do you think? Could this work?
